Something HUGE is currently going on right now in Star Wars as it pertains to the actress Gina Carano and her character Cara Dune from The Mandalorian. Her base cards are starting to sell for more than The Child. I am a collector of the Topps Star Wars Masterwork annual product. It is the flagship set that Topps produces annually since 2015. I knew that the 2020 Masterwork set was going to be absolutely a strong product as it was the introduction of the characters from The Mandalorian for the first time in Masterwork. One of my friends sold the base card of The Child (raw) for $58 a few weeks ago. However, recent developments between Disney and Lucasfilm have elevated actress and former MMA fighter Gina Carano into the limelight. All of her cards are ON FIRE!!! The current sets that are out may be the only chance for collectors to acquire one of her cards. That's where 2020 Masterwork is so special. The 2020 Masterwork base sets had a print run of only around 750 total sets. The non-numbered blue parallel sets had a print run of roughly 250 total sets, green - 99, purple - 50, orange - 10, black - 5, and gold 1/1. So, there are only a total of 1,165 total cards of all varieties of the base card to go around for any of the characters. So, if collectors seek out these examples, they will have to pay huge premiums for Topps premium and most limited product. Search Gina Carano/Cara Dune to see what all the hype is. @dscomics5603
@dscomics5603 3 жыл бұрын
There's just no way, longterm, that demand can stay ahead of the supply of 90s marvel cards. Aside from people who are digging out their cards from their childhood, these sets were mass produced right around the time when comic/hobby shops started shutting down en mass so there's tons of sealed boxes, like literally millions of em, in storage. Cool stuff, but not worth investing in longterm. There's a never ending string of these sealed boxes hitting ebay daily with no end in sight.
@thomasc1753
@thomasc1753 3 жыл бұрын
Not sure that many boxes and cases survived. (Doing a basic quick search) There are less than 75 1990 Marvel Series 1 sealed boxes on ebay as I write this. Now, either they are all being ripped and subbed, or there aren't THAT many millions in the private sector that made it through the last 30 years. Pop will go up for sure, but they are starting at rock bottom numbers. I also don't see THAT many singles on ebay comparatively to how many boxes may exist. Certainly something to watch!

Hi Vic, are you a wrestling card or collector of The Rock? I was in my younger days and still have all my Rock wrestling cards dating back to 1998. I have what I believe is a super rare card. It’s from Rock Solid: The Peoples Trading Card Series, a set released in 2000 by Comic Images and the whole set features The Rock. There were supposed to be 2 autographed cards that you could pull from packs, cards numbered A1 and A2. These cards were pulled from release because of a conflict with WWF. I actually have the A1 signed card, with full authentication on the back of the card. I have never seen another one anywhere in 21 years. I’m debating on putting it up on eBay to see what happens.
